Transaction d38b7835514abbebd892e2f21d7e1c379f709d1a18cb44e4070ee29f381413cf
1 Input
2 Outputs
- d38b7835514abbebd892e2f21d7e1c379f709d1a18cb44e4070ee29f381413cf:0
- d38b7835514abbebd892e2f21d7e1c379f709d1a18cb44e4070ee29f381413cf:1
value 4840668
address 1Jvru5sR33xSSH83reweW6C6PgPu53ns54
value 73736158
address 12H2FQS2ZMz5Pm6wxJMbunYGo5iKnDfWnZ